TrackTelemetry Traccar PHP SDK
Track Telemetry Laravel Traccar is a Laravel specific composer package that simplifies integration with the Traccar GPS tracking platform. It provides an elegant, expressive API to interact with Traccar’s REST endpoints.
Requirements
Version | PHP | Composer | Laravel |
---|---|---|---|
1.x | >= 8.4 | Required | >= 11.x |
Installation
You can install the package via Composer
composer require tracktelemetry/traccar
Configuration
Environment variables
TRACCAR_API_KEY
– Your Traccar API tokenTRACCAR_BASE_URL
– Base API URL (defaulthttps://demo.traccar.org/api
)
Configuration
You can publish the configuration by running the following command:
php artisan vendor:publish --tag=config --provider="TrackTelemetry\\Traccar\\TraccarServiceProvider"
Usage
Here is a quick example of how to get server information.
use TrackTelemetry\Traccar\Facades\Traccar; // returns TrackTelemetry\Traccar\Dto\ServerData $info = Server::getInformation(); $version = $info->version; // '6.10' $speedUnit = $info->attributes->speedUnit->value; // 'kn', 'kmh', or 'mph' $timezone = $info->attributes->timezone; // e.g. 'UTC'
